Definitions of thudded word
- noun thudded a dull sound, as of a heavy blow or fall. 1
- noun thudded a blow causing such a sound. 1
- verb without object thudded to strike or fall with a dull sound of heavy impact. 1

Origin of thudded
First appearance:
before 1505 One of the 26% oldest English words
1505-15; imitative; compare Middle English thudden, Old English thyddan to strike, press
